Day 1: 1976 Airstream Overlander at the Manor
Today we moved the 1976 Airstream Overlander to the concrete pad in front of Dennis's shop for inspection and a "first look" for me. It has that wonderful Airstream shape and style, but is desperately in need of renovation.
Our neighbors originally bought this Airstream hoping to use it as a portable coffee truck for the business they used to run, but that never came to fruition. So, it's still in the same condition it was when they purchased it years ago.
At this point, our plan is to do a total off frame rebuild. We may still have to ditch the project if when we remove the shell from the frame we determine that it is just not able to be restored. While that would be disappointing, we would rather stop while we are ahead. Airstream campers are not rare, and we can always be on the lookout for another one in much better shape.
